I've got two of these. I like them a lot, so much so when I melted one on a bike's exhaust I had to buy another. They're marketed as a jumper/fleece but if you buy your right size they fit pretty tight like as jumper so go 2 sizes up if ya want to wear it as a fleece. Hope that makes sense. I'm a 40-42 chest and the medium is a tad small though not restrictive. The large is just right.

Pro's...Warm, comfortable, look good, light.

Con's..Expensive for what they are, horrible when wet although waterproof, bobble and look old pretty quick, pockets too small and linings ripped to shreds pretty quickly.

That sounds like a lot of con's but I just love mine. I've worn it all winter. It's one of those items that's just so comfortable you can't let it go. I wouldn't wear it in the woods though as they don't feel very robust. As casual wear they look and feel great, and can be found on ebay for £45.
